Full Review

What is IPVanish?

IPVanish is a U.S.-based VPN service best known for offering unlimited simultaneous connections, allowing users to protect every device in their household with a single subscription.

It provides a comprehensive suite of privacy tools, broad platform support, and has undergone independent audits to verify its no-logs policy.

Privacy & Security

Privacy & Security: 4.5 out of 5

IPVanish offers strong privacy features without getting complicated:

  • No-logs policy confirmed by independent audits - your activity isn’t tracked or stored
  • Quarterly Transparence reports showing requests received for data from Government, law enforcement and civil with zero data provided
  • Kill switch protects your privacy if the connection drops
  • Threat Protection helps block trackers, ads, and malicious websites
  • WireGuard and OpenVPN support - both strong encryption protocols

Your browsing stays private - even on shared Wi-Fi or public hotspots.

Features & Tools

Features and Tools: 4.4 out of 5

IPVanish includes a solid range of tools for privacy and convenience:

  • Threat Protection: Blocks trackers, ads, and known malicious websites
  • Split tunneling: Choose which apps use the VPN (available on Android and Fire TV)
  • Kill switch: Automatically blocks your internet if the VPN disconnects, so nothing slips through unprotected
  • DNS leak protection: Stops websites from seeing your real location or internet provider
  • Secure cloud storage add-on (via SugarSync)
  • WireGuard protocol for fast and secure connections

IPVanish keeps things simple - all the essentials are here, and they work without needing technical know-how.

📊How This VPN Was Tested

This VPN was tested using the Enfinnit Global Stress Test (EGST) - a structured, repeatable framework designed to evaluate how VPNs behave under real-world conditions rather than ideal, short-term tests.

EGST focuses on four core testing pillars that reflect how people actually use a VPN day to day:

Speed and Performance:

I run multiple speed tests on a modern home broadband connection to understand how the VPN affects everyday activities like streaming, browsing, downloads, and video calls. To assess global performance, tests are conducted across servers in North America, Europe, Asia, and Australia, with results reflecting sustained use rather than one-off measurements.

Security and Location Masking:

I verify that the VPN successfully hides your real location by checking for DNS, WebRTC, and IPv6 leaks under active connection conditions. I also confirm the use of modern, secure VPN protocols to ensure traffic is properly protected while connected.

Privacy and Logging Practices:

Privacy claims are evaluated beyond marketing statements. This includes reviewing published privacy policies, corporate structure and jurisdiction, and any available independent verification. “No-logs” claims are scrutinized carefully, with greater weight given to providers that support those claims through independent, up-to-date public-facing audits, legal precedent, or other verifiable evidence rather than policy language alone.

Greater confidence is placed in providers whose privacy assurances can be corroborated.

Real-World Usability:

I assess how easy the VPN is to use across common devices, whether it reliably accesses popular streaming services from different regions, and how responsive and knowledgeable customer support is when contacted with real questions.
